Five things we learnt from Steve Evans’s first game in charge of Peterborough

Steve Evans made his first appearance on the touchline for his beloved Peterborough United, his side managed to beat Charlton 4-1 and here are five things we learnt from the game –

1) Steve Evans will implement 4-4-2 at Peterborough United.

As expected Evans went with a 4-4-2 formation with Maddison and Joe Ward out wide and Portuguese teenager Leo da Silva Lopes recalled to play in a position he enjoys and performs in. Charlton managed to dominate possession, but found it to break Posh down, as much for their own poor passing tempo as for a resilient defensive display by Posh skipper Jack Baldwin and the rest of the back line.
